Responsibilities
  • Encouraging people to live as independently as possible, while supporting them in building their life skills and achieving goals at their own pace
  • Supervise colleagues, lead team meetings and support your peers with their performance and professional development
  • Lead support planning and act as point of contact in the absence of site leadership
  • Assist with the management of site petty cash and client funds
  • Supporting with personal care tasks, such as washing, dressing, eating and personal care
  • Performing light housekeeping tasks, such as dusting, vacuuming, and changing bed clothes
  • Assisting with safe lifting, transferring, repositioning and movement of individuals
  • Assistance and support to attend medical appointments
  • Observe, monitor, and record physical and emotional well-being, and quickly report any changes to senior staff
  • Supporting the development of important family connections and liaising with specialists, including Speech & Language Therapists and Learning Disability teams
  • Encouraging participation in social and recreational activities that promote involvement and personal growth

Additional Information

Based in Radstock, Somerset, Priory Radstock offers residential support for 12 autistic people. We are situated on a main road, in the local town of Radstock. We provide residential support, 24 hours a day, in an environment that has open living communal spaces and separate living facilities. We support our residents to access the community and live as independent a life as possible, in the least restrictive way, using a positive behaviour support (PBS) approach.

Disclosure

All roles will be subject to a successful disclosure at an appropriate level from the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S), Access NI or Disclosure Scotland, and the cost of this will be covered by Priory.
